Output d7121f9287d7ee6d383a13e7a4e4a5686fa54d8b6301f410bd3f7d70f923613a:1

value
1235783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d612cbac211aa2ebd57364ae4bc73fa064227c1 OP_EQUAL
address
3MsZfkqB3S4m1RrXyHVroMzdLUvvxLLrcM
transaction
d7121f9287d7ee6d383a13e7a4e4a5686fa54d8b6301f410bd3f7d70f923613a
spent
true